The Beretta CX4 Storm is a 9mm pistol-caliber carbine featuring a polymer construction and a cold hammer-forged 16-inch barrel. It boasts fully ambidextrous controls and compatibility with Beretta 92 and PX4 series pistol magazines, enhancing its utility. The carbine includes adjustable iron sights and a unique retractable accessory rail, making it a versatile option for self-defense and range use.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the key features of the Beretta CX4 Storm carbine?

The Beretta CX4 Storm is a 9mm carbine with a 16-inch cold hammer-forged barrel, mostly polymer construction, and fully ambidextrous controls. It features adjustable iron sights and a retractable accessory rail, and is compatible with Beretta 92 and PX4 pistol magazines.

Is the Beretta CX4 Storm ambidextrous?

Yes, the Beretta CX4 Storm is fully ambidextrous. The magazine release, bolt handle, safety, and ejection port can all be swapped from left to right to suit the shooter's preference.

What ammunition was tested in the Beretta CX4 Storm review?

The review tested various 9mm loads including Winchester 115gr ball, Federal HST 124gr, Federal 147gr hollow points, and Sellier & Bellot 140gr subsonics to assess the carbine's reliability and accuracy.

Can the Beretta CX4 Storm accept optics?

Yes, the CX4 Storm is designed to accommodate optics. It features flip-down iron sights that clear the way for low-mounted red dot sights, and also has accessory rails for mounting other optics.
